1992 Alfa Romeo 155 vs. 2011 Kia Cee'd

To start off, 2011 Kia Cee'd is newer by 19 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1992 Alfa Romeo 155.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1992 Alfa Romeo 155 would be higher. At 2,492 cc (6 cylinders), 1992 Alfa Romeo 155 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1992 Alfa Romeo 155 (164 HP @ 5800 RPM) has 40 more horse power than 2011 Kia Cee'd. (124 HP @ 6200 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1992 Alfa Romeo 155 should accelerate faster than 2011 Kia Cee'd.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2011 Kia Cee'd weights approximately 27 kg more than 1992 Alfa Romeo 155.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1992 Alfa Romeo 155 (217 Nm @ 4500 RPM) has 62 more torque (in Nm) than 2011 Kia Cee'd. (155 Nm @ 5200 RPM). This means 1992 Alfa Romeo 155 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2011 Kia Cee'd.

Compare all specifications:

1992 Alfa Romeo 155 2011 Kia Cee'd
Make Alfa Romeo Kia
Model 155 Cee'd
Year Released 1992 2011
Body Type Sedan Hatchback
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 2492 cc 1591 cc
Engine Cylinders 6 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Horse Power 164 HP 124 HP
Engine RPM 5800 RPM 6200 RPM
Torque 217 Nm 155 Nm
Torque RPM 4500 RPM 5200 RPM
Engine Bore Size 88.1 mm 77 mm
Engine Stroke Size 68.3 mm 85.4 mm
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line - Premium
Drive Type Front Front
Number of Seats 5 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 4 doors 5 doors
Vehicle Weight 1290 kg 1317 kg
Vehicle Length 4450 mm 4480 mm
Vehicle Width 1710 mm 1800 mm
Vehicle Height 1450 mm 1530 mm
